What's The Definition Of Hyperplasia?

hyperplasia in American English
an abnormal increase in the number of cells composing a tissue or organ
noun: abnormal multiplication of cells

hyperplasia in British English
noun: enlargement of a bodily organ or part resulting from an increase in the total number of cells
